Machine Learning Engineer I
Date: Feb 24, 2026
Location: Dhaka, BD, 1212 BD
Company: Optimizely
At Optimizely, we're on a mission to help people unlock their digital potential. We do that by reinventing how marketing and product teams work to create and optimize digital experiences across all channels. With Optimizely One, our industry-first operating system for marketers, we offer teams flexibility and choice to build their stack their way with our fully SaaS, fully decoupled, and highly composable solution.
We are proud to help more than 10,000 businesses, including H&M, PayPal, Zoom, and Toyota, enrich their customer lifetime value, increase revenue and grow their brands. Our innovation and excellence have earned us numerous recognitions as a leader by industry analysts such as Gartner, Forrester, and IDC, reinforcing our role as a trailblazer in MarTech.
At our core, we believe work is about more than just numbers -- it's about the people. Our culture is dynamic and constantly evolving, shaped by every employee, their actions and their stories. With over 1600 Optimizers spread across 12 global locations, our diverse team embodies the "One Optimizely" spirit, emphasizing collaboration and continuous improvement, while fostering a culture where every voice is heard and valued.
Join us and become part of a company that's empowering people to unlock their digital potential!
Introduction
We are looking for machine learning engineer who are passionate about building scalable machine learning applications and use data driven approaches to generate business isnights. As a key member of the Data Services team you will have the opportunity to build machine learning models and design/automate/deploy machines learning pipelines to solve key business problems across an array of technology. You will be working with a group of data scientists, data engineers, product owners and business SMEs to build intelligent & innovative solutions. You will be highly encouraged to explore new technologies and come up with innovative solutions that could take the team’s data science machine learning engineering capability to the next level.
Job Responsibilities
Key Responsibilities:
- Write programs and develop algorithms to extract meaningful information from large amounts of both structured and unstructured data
- Preparation of data sets to feed into the algorithm
- Analysis and development of data structures
- Dealing with machine learning solutions for data processing
- Conduct experiments and test different approaches
- Optimize programs to improve performance, speed, and scalability
- Collaborate with data engineering to ensure clean records
- Recommend useful machine learning applications
- Work with internal stakeholders to explore and understand business data.
- Implement machine learning model lifecycle management framework.
- Build model performance tracking tools, to monitor model performance, identify drivers and provide recommendations for optimization
- Author technical documentation and reports to communicate process and results
Knowledge and Experience
- Experience in machine learning, data analysis, or a related field.
- Understanding of machine learning algorithms, techniques, and evaluation metrics.
- Proficiency in programming languages such as Python, SQL, and experience with machine learning libraries and frameworks (e.g., scikit-learn, TensorFlow, PyTorch).
- Experience with data manipulation, feature engineering, and data preprocessing techniques.
- Excellent problem-solving, analytical, and critical thinking skills.
- Strong communication and presentation skills, with the ability to explain complex technical concepts to non-technical audiences.
- Ability to work collaboratively in a team environment and manage multiple projects simultaneously.
Education
Bachelor’s Degree or equivalent work experience
Competencies
Our new, cutting-edge office space in Dhaka is a testament to our dedication to enhancing your work experience. This state-of-the-art workspace features open workstations, a fully equipped kitchen, a nap room for relaxation, a tranquil zen garden, and an entertaining area, all designed to provide you with the ideal environment to thrive and grow.
As part of our commitment to you, here are other benefits and perks you can expect:
-
Best-in-class compensation plans
-
Two annual festival bonuses
-
Recognition and rewards programs
-
Vacations days
-
Annual Work/Service Anniversary Leave
-
Parental leave (both maternity and paternity)
-
Health insurance
-
Reproductive benefits for both parents
-
Volunteering opportunities to make a difference
-
Chance to work alongside our incredible global team
-
Free communal transport facilities inside Dhaka to and from the office
-
Free catered lunch every day
At Optimizely, our standardized language is English, and it is crucial to have good English communication skills to be successful in your global role. All our external and cross-location communication is done in US English (en-us), but internally you can speak in whichever native language you most identify with.
Optimizely is committed to a diverse and inclusive workplace. Optimizely is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status.